A bypass capacitor plays a vital role in ensuring clean and stable DC power in electronic circuits. It shunts unwanted AC signals and noise to ground, allowing pure DC to pass to sensitive components like amplifiers or microcontrollers.
In amplifier circuits, especially with transistors, an emitter bypass capacitor improves gain by offering a low-impedance path for AC signals, avoiding feedback issues.
Common Applications:
1) Power conditioning
2) DC-DC converters
3) Amplifiers
4) Signal filtering
5) Clock/calendar circuits
Typical Value: 0.1µF to 1µF (with 0.1 µF widely used for high-frequency noise suppression)
Proper use of bypass capacitors helps eliminate ripples, reduce interference, and enhance performance in both analog and digital circuits.
